Lines Matching refs:wr32

587 	wr32(E1000_I2CPARAMS, i2cctl);  in igb_set_i2c_data()
610 wr32(E1000_I2CPARAMS, i2cctl); in igb_set_i2c_clk()
883 wr32(E1000_CTRL_EXT, tmp); in igb_configure_msix()
900 wr32(E1000_GPIE, E1000_GPIE_MSIX_MODE | in igb_configure_msix()
908 wr32(E1000_IVAR_MISC, tmp); in igb_configure_msix()
1148 wr32(E1000_IOVCTL, E1000_IOVCTL_REUSE_VFQ); in igb_set_interrupt_capability()
1485 wr32(E1000_EIAM, regval & ~adapter->eims_enable_mask); in igb_irq_disable()
1486 wr32(E1000_EIMC, adapter->eims_enable_mask); in igb_irq_disable()
1488 wr32(E1000_EIAC, regval & ~adapter->eims_enable_mask); in igb_irq_disable()
1491 wr32(E1000_IAM, 0); in igb_irq_disable()
1492 wr32(E1000_IMC, ~0); in igb_irq_disable()
1516 wr32(E1000_EIAC, regval | adapter->eims_enable_mask); in igb_irq_enable()
1518 wr32(E1000_EIAM, regval | adapter->eims_enable_mask); in igb_irq_enable()
1519 wr32(E1000_EIMS, adapter->eims_enable_mask); in igb_irq_enable()
1521 wr32(E1000_MBVFIMR, 0xFF); in igb_irq_enable()
1524 wr32(E1000_IMS, ims); in igb_irq_enable()
1526 wr32(E1000_IMS, IMS_ENABLE_MASK | in igb_irq_enable()
1528 wr32(E1000_IAM, IMS_ENABLE_MASK | in igb_irq_enable()
1571 wr32(E1000_CTRL_EXT, in igb_release_hw_control()
1590 wr32(E1000_CTRL_EXT, in igb_get_hw_control()
1630 wr32(E1000_I210_TXDCTL(queue), val); in set_tx_desc_fetch_prio()
1647 wr32(E1000_I210_TQAVCC(queue), val); in set_queue_mode()
1731 wr32(E1000_I210_TQAVCTRL, tqavctrl); in igb_config_tx_modes()
1795 wr32(E1000_I210_TQAVCC(queue), tqavcc); in igb_config_tx_modes()
1797 wr32(E1000_I210_TQAVHC(queue), in igb_config_tx_modes()
1804 wr32(E1000_I210_TQAVCC(queue), tqavcc); in igb_config_tx_modes()
1807 wr32(E1000_I210_TQAVHC(queue), 0); in igb_config_tx_modes()
1816 wr32(E1000_I210_TQAVCTRL, tqavctrl); in igb_config_tx_modes()
1833 wr32(E1000_I210_TQAVCTRL, tqavctrl); in igb_config_tx_modes()
1843 wr32(E1000_I210_TQAVCTRL, tqavctrl); in igb_config_tx_modes()
1923 wr32(E1000_I210_TQAVCTRL, val); in igb_setup_tx_mode()
1932 wr32(E1000_TXPBS, val); in igb_setup_tx_mode()
1937 wr32(E1000_RXPBS, val); in igb_setup_tx_mode()
1951 wr32(E1000_I210_DTXMXPKTSZ, val); in igb_setup_tx_mode()
1965 wr32(E1000_RXPBS, I210_RXPBSIZE_DEFAULT); in igb_setup_tx_mode()
1966 wr32(E1000_TXPBS, I210_TXPBSIZE_DEFAULT); in igb_setup_tx_mode()
1967 wr32(E1000_I210_DTXMXPKTSZ, I210_DTXMXPKTSZ_DEFAULT); in igb_setup_tx_mode()
1975 wr32(E1000_I210_TQAVCTRL, val); in igb_setup_tx_mode()
2071 wr32(E1000_CONNSW, connsw); in igb_check_swap_media()
2079 wr32(E1000_CONNSW, connsw); in igb_check_swap_media()
2110 wr32(E1000_CTRL_EXT, ctrl_ext); in igb_check_swap_media()
2145 wr32(E1000_CTRL_EXT, reg_data); in igb_up()
2175 wr32(E1000_RCTL, rctl & ~E1000_RCTL_EN); in igb_down()
2186 wr32(E1000_TCTL, tctl); in igb_down()
2251 wr32(E1000_CONNSW, connsw); in igb_enable_mas()
2290 wr32(E1000_PBA, pba); in igb_reset()
2328 wr32(E1000_PBA, pba); in igb_reset()
2358 wr32(E1000_VFRE, 0); in igb_reset()
2359 wr32(E1000_VFTE, 0); in igb_reset()
2364 wr32(E1000_WUC, 0); in igb_reset()
2425 wr32(E1000_VET, ETHERNET_IEEE_VLAN_TYPE); in igb_reset()
3129 wr32(E1000_I2CPARAMS, i2cctl); in igb_init_i2c()
3374 wr32(E1000_RXPBS, I210_RXPBSIZE_DEFAULT); in igb_probe()
3375 wr32(E1000_TXPBS, I210_TXPBSIZE_DEFAULT); in igb_probe()
3660 wr32(E1000_IOVCTL, E1000_IOVCTL_REUSE_VFQ); in igb_disable_sriov()
3809 wr32(E1000_DCA_CTRL, E1000_DCA_CTRL_DCA_MODE_DISABLE); in igb_remove()
4121 wr32(E1000_CTRL_EXT, reg_data); in __igb_open()
4270 wr32(E1000_TXDCTL(0), 0); in igb_setup_tctl()
4283 wr32(E1000_TCTL, tctl); in igb_setup_tctl()
4301 wr32(E1000_TDLEN(reg_idx), in igb_configure_tx_ring()
4303 wr32(E1000_TDBAL(reg_idx), in igb_configure_tx_ring()
4305 wr32(E1000_TDBAH(reg_idx), tdba >> 32); in igb_configure_tx_ring()
4308 wr32(E1000_TDH(reg_idx), 0); in igb_configure_tx_ring()
4320 wr32(E1000_TXDCTL(reg_idx), txdctl); in igb_configure_tx_ring()
4336 wr32(E1000_TXDCTL(adapter->tx_ring[i]->reg_idx), 0); in igb_configure_tx()
4438 wr32(E1000_RSSRK(j), rss_key[j]); in igb_setup_mrqc()
4472 wr32(E1000_RXCSUM, rxcsum); in igb_setup_mrqc()
4501 wr32(E1000_VT_CTL, vtctl); in igb_setup_mrqc()
4512 wr32(E1000_MRQC, mrqc); in igb_setup_mrqc()
4545 wr32(E1000_RXDCTL(0), 0); in igb_setup_rctl()
4553 wr32(E1000_QDE, ALL_QUEUES); in igb_setup_rctl()
4572 wr32(E1000_RCTL, rctl); in igb_setup_rctl()
4587 wr32(E1000_VMOLR(vfn), vmolr); in igb_set_vf_rlpml()
4611 wr32(reg, val); in igb_set_vf_vlan_strip()
4643 wr32(E1000_VMOLR(vfn), vmolr); in igb_set_vmolr()
4674 wr32(E1000_SRRCTL(reg_idx), srrctl); in igb_setup_srrctl()
4698 wr32(E1000_RXDCTL(reg_idx), 0); in igb_configure_rx_ring()
4701 wr32(E1000_RDBAL(reg_idx), in igb_configure_rx_ring()
4703 wr32(E1000_RDBAH(reg_idx), rdba >> 32); in igb_configure_rx_ring()
4704 wr32(E1000_RDLEN(reg_idx), in igb_configure_rx_ring()
4709 wr32(E1000_RDH(reg_idx), 0); in igb_configure_rx_ring()
4732 wr32(E1000_RXDCTL(reg_idx), rxdctl); in igb_configure_rx_ring()
5094 wr32(E1000_VLVF(i), vlvf); in igb_vlan_promisc_enable()
5149 wr32(E1000_VLVF(i), bits); in igb_scrub_vfta()
5249 wr32(E1000_RCTL, rctl); in igb_set_rx_mode()
5257 wr32(E1000_RLPML, rlpml); in igb_set_rx_mode()
5283 wr32(E1000_VMOLR(vfn), vmolr); in igb_set_rx_mode()
5625 wr32(E1000_EICS, eics); in igb_watchdog_task()
5627 wr32(E1000_ICS, E1000_ICS_RXDMT0); in igb_watchdog_task()
6470 wr32(E1000_EICS, in igb_tx_timeout()
6594 wr32(E1000_RQDPC(i), 0); in igb_update_stats()
6821 wr32((tsintr_tt == 1) ? E1000_TRGTTIML1 : E1000_TRGTTIML0, ts.tv_nsec); in igb_perout()
6822 wr32((tsintr_tt == 1) ? E1000_TRGTTIMH1 : E1000_TRGTTIMH0, (u32)ts.tv_sec); in igb_perout()
6825 wr32(E1000_TSAUXC, tsauxc); in igb_perout()
6901 wr32(E1000_TSICR, ack); in igb_tsync_interrupt()
6938 wr32(E1000_EIMS, adapter->eims_other); in igb_msix_other()
6994 wr32(E1000_DCA_TXCTRL(tx_ring->reg_idx), txctrl); in igb_update_tx_dca()
7014 wr32(E1000_DCA_RXCTRL(rx_ring->reg_idx), rxctrl); in igb_update_rx_dca()
7045 wr32(E1000_DCA_CTRL, E1000_DCA_CTRL_DCA_MODE_CB2); in igb_setup_dca()
7081 wr32(E1000_DCA_CTRL, E1000_DCA_CTRL_DCA_MODE_DISABLE); in __igb_notify_dca()
7163 wr32(E1000_VMOLR(vf), vmolr); in igb_set_vf_promisc()
7221 wr32(E1000_VMOLR(i), vmolr); in igb_restore_vf_multicasts()
7273 wr32(E1000_VLVF(i), vlvf); in igb_clear_vf_vfta()
7316 wr32(E1000_VLVF(idx), BIT(pf_id)); in igb_update_pf_vlvf()
7318 wr32(E1000_VLVF(idx), 0); in igb_update_pf_vlvf()
7361 wr32(E1000_VMVIR(vf), (vid | E1000_VMVIR_VLANA_DEFAULT)); in igb_set_vmvir()
7363 wr32(E1000_VMVIR(vf), 0); in igb_set_vmvir()
7502 wr32(E1000_VFTE, reg | BIT(vf)); in igb_vf_reset_msg()
7504 wr32(E1000_VFRE, reg | BIT(vf)); in igb_vf_reset_msg()
8077 wr32(E1000_EIMS, q_vector->eims_value); in igb_ring_irq_enable()
9127 wr32(E1000_CTRL, ctrl); in igb_vlan_mode()
9132 wr32(E1000_RCTL, rctl); in igb_vlan_mode()
9137 wr32(E1000_CTRL, ctrl); in igb_vlan_mode()
9278 wr32(E1000_RCTL, rctl); in __igb_shutdown()
9283 wr32(E1000_CTRL, ctrl); in __igb_shutdown()
9288 wr32(E1000_WUC, E1000_WUC_PME_EN); in __igb_shutdown()
9289 wr32(E1000_WUFC, wufc); in __igb_shutdown()
9291 wr32(E1000_WUC, 0); in __igb_shutdown()
9292 wr32(E1000_WUFC, 0); in __igb_shutdown()
9390 wr32(E1000_WUS, ~0); in __igb_resume()
9571 wr32(E1000_WUS, ~0); in igb_io_slot_reset()
9650 wr32(E1000_RAL(index), rar_low); in igb_rar_set_index()
9652 wr32(E1000_RAH(index), rar_high); in igb_rar_set_index()
9745 wr32(E1000_RTTDQSEL, vf); /* vf X uses queue X */ in igb_set_vf_rate_limit()
9749 wr32(E1000_RTTBCNRM, 0x14); in igb_set_vf_rate_limit()
9750 wr32(E1000_RTTBCNRC, bcnrc_val); in igb_set_vf_rate_limit()
9829 wr32(reg_offset, reg_val); in igb_ndo_set_vf_spoofchk()
9885 wr32(E1000_DTXCTL, reg); in igb_vmm_control()
9891 wr32(E1000_RPLOLR, reg); in igb_vmm_control()
9919 wr32(E1000_DMCTXTH, 0); in igb_init_dmac()
9930 wr32(E1000_FCRTC, reg); in igb_init_dmac()
9950 wr32(E1000_DMACR, reg); in igb_init_dmac()
9955 wr32(E1000_DMCRTRH, 0); in igb_init_dmac()
9959 wr32(E1000_DMCTLX, reg); in igb_init_dmac()
9964 wr32(E1000_DMCTXTH, (IGB_MIN_TXPBSIZE - in igb_init_dmac()
9972 wr32(E1000_PCIEMISC, reg); in igb_init_dmac()
9977 wr32(E1000_PCIEMISC, reg & ~E1000_PCIEMISC_LX_DECISION); in igb_init_dmac()
9978 wr32(E1000_DMACR, 0); in igb_init_dmac()